Share via


IX509CertificateRequestPkcs10::get_RawDataToBeSigned (certenroll.h)

La propiedad RawDataToBeSigned recupera la solicitud de certificado sin firmar creada por el método Encode . La solicitud está contenida en una matriz de bytes codificada mediante reglas de codificación distinguida (DER) tal como se define en el estándar Notación de sintaxis abstracta Uno (ASN.1). La matriz de bytes con codificación DER se representa mediante una cadena que es una secuencia binaria pura o está codificada en Unicode.

Esta propiedad es de solo lectura.

Sintaxis

HRESULT get_RawDataToBeSigned(
  EncodingType Encoding,
  BSTR         *pValue
);

Parámetros

Encoding

pValue

Valor devuelto

None

Observaciones

El método Encode crea una solicitud de certificado con codificación DER y firmada, pero también guarda internamente la solicitud sin firmar como una matriz de bytes. Puede usar la propiedad RawDataToBeSigned para recuperar esos datos binarios como una cadena con codificación Unicode.

Debe inicializar el objeto IX509CertificateRequestPkcs10 y llamar a Encode antes de llamar a esta propiedad. Para obtener más información, consulte cualquiera de los métodos siguientes:

Requisitos

Requisito Value
Cliente mínimo compatible Windows Vista [solo aplicaciones de escritorio]
Servidor mínimo compatible Windows Server 2008 [solo aplicaciones de escritorio]
Plataforma de destino Windows
Encabezado certenroll.h
Archivo DLL CertEnroll.dll

Consulte también

IX509CertificateRequestPkcs10